The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 80 and 86, than apply into the LCM equation.
GCF(80,86) = 2
LCM(80,86) = ( 80 × 86) / 2
LCM(80,86) = 6880 / 2
LCM(80,86) = 3440

5. How to Find the LCM of 80 and 86?Answer:
Least Common Multiple of 80 and 86 = 3440
Step 1: Find the prime factorization of 80
80 = 2 x 2 x 2 x 2 x 5
Step 2: Find the prime factorization of 86
86 = 2 x 43
Step 3: Multiply each factor the greater number of times it occurs in steps i) or ii) above to find the lcm:
LCM = 3440 = 2 x 2 x 2 x 2 x 5 x 43
Step 4: Therefore, the least common multiple of 80 and 86 is 3440.
